Chelsea star risks fans backlash after praising rivals Arsenal ahead of showdown

Chelsea midfielder Cesc Fabregas has paid tribute to Arsenal and Arsene Wenger, revealing he will be ‘forever grateful' for what they did for his career. The 29-year-old will line up against his former manager and some ex-teammates on Saturday at Stamford Bridge as Chelsea look to take another big step towards winning the Premier League this season. While his allegiance now lies with the Blues since his move from Barcelona in 2014, he made over 300 appearances for the Gunners and still holds them in high regard given the influence they had on his career.
